ANYONE who would like to contribute to the potential implementation of an early closing trial for Orange hotels is invited to a meeting on Wednesday to be hosted by the Orange and District Ministers’ Association (ODMA).
Spokesperson for the ODMA, Bev Rankin said any stakeholders including publicans, any liquor outlet representatives and others from NSW Health, Orange taxis, Orange City Council and emergency services affected by late night trading are invited to the meeting to be held at 4pm at the Fusion Centre in the Uniting Church complex in Anson Street.
She said members of the general public are also invited.
The ODMA voted at a meeting last week to call on Orange’s three late- night trading hotels to cut back trading hours and not sell alcohol after midnight as part of a trial the organisation would like to see start at the end of the month.
